/**
* URLs are loaded lazily when used. This allows adapter to be deployed prior to Keycloak server starting, and will
* also allow the adapter to retry loading config for each request until the Keycloak server is ready.
*
* In the future we may want to support reloading config at a configurable interval.
*/
protected void resolveUrls() {
if (realmInfoUrl == null) {
synchronized (this) {
if (realmInfoUrl == null) {
KeycloakUriBuilder authUrlBuilder = KeycloakUriBuilder
.fromUri(authServerBaseUrl);
String discoveryUrl = authUrlBuilder.clone()
.path(ServiceUrlConstants.DISCOVERY_URL).build(getRealm()).toString();
try {
log.debugv("Resolving URLs from {0}", discoveryUrl);
OIDCConfigurationRepresentation config = getOidcConfiguration(discoveryUrl);
authUrl = KeycloakUriBuilder.fromUri(config.getAuthorizationEndpoint());
realmInfoUrl = config.getIssuer();
tokenUrl = config.getTokenEndpoint();
logoutUrl = KeycloakUriBuilder.fromUri(config.getLogoutEndpoint());
accountUrl = KeycloakUriBuilder.fromUri(config.getIssuer()).path("/account")
.build().toString();
registerNodeUrl = authUrlBuilder.clone()
.path(ServiceUrlConstants.CLIENTS_MANAGEMENT_REGISTER_NODE_PATH)
.build(getRealm()).toString();
unregisterNodeUrl = authUrlBuilder.clone()
.path(ServiceUrlConstants.CLIENTS_MANAGEMENT_UNREGISTER_NODE_PATH)
.build(getRealm()).toString();
jwksUrl = config.getJwksUri();
log.infov("Loaded URLs from {0}", discoveryUrl);
} catch (Exception e) {
log.warnv(e, "Failed to load URLs from {0}", discoveryUrl);
}
}
}
}
}
protected void resolveUrls(KeycloakUriBuilder authUrlBuilder) {
if (log.isDebugEnabled()) {
log.debug("resolveUrls");
}
String login = authUrlBuilder.clone().path(ServiceUrlConstants.AUTH_PATH).build(getRealm()).toString();
authUrl = KeycloakUriBuilder.fromUri(login);
realmInfoUrl = authUrlBuilder.clone().path(ServiceUrlConstants.REALM_INFO_PATH).build(getRealm()).toString();
tokenUrl = authUrlBuilder.clone().path(ServiceUrlConstants.TOKEN_PATH).build(getRealm()).toString();
logoutUrl = KeycloakUriBuilder.fromUri(authUrlBuilder.clone().path(ServiceUrlConstants.TOKEN_SERVICE_LOGOUT_PATH).build(getRealm()).toString());
accountUrl = authUrlBuilder.clone().path(ServiceUrlConstants.ACCOUNT_SERVICE_PATH).build(getRealm()).toString();
registerNodeUrl = authUrlBuilder.clone().path(ServiceUrlConstants.CLIENTS_MANAGEMENT_REGISTER_NODE_PATH).build(getRealm()).toString();
unregisterNodeUrl = authUrlBuilder.clone().path(ServiceUrlConstants.CLIENTS_MANAGEMENT_UNREGISTER_NODE_PATH).build(getRealm()).toString();
jwksUrl = authUrlBuilder.clone().path(ServiceUrlConstants.JWKS_URL).build(getRealm()).toString();
}
protected OIDCConfigurationRepresentation getOidcConfiguration(String discoveryUrl) throws Exception {
HttpGet request = new HttpGet(discoveryUrl);
request.addHeader("accept", "application/json");
try {
HttpResponse response = getClient().execute(request);
if (response.getStatusLine().getStatusCode() != 200) {
EntityUtils.consumeQuietly(response.getEntity());
throw new Exception(response.getStatusLine().getReasonPhrase());
}
return JsonSerialization.readValue(response.getEntity().getContent(), OIDCConfigurationRepresentation.class);
} finally {
request.releaseConnection();
}
}
